73-Year Old Woman Killed in Cold Blood in Rukungiri

The Police in Rukungiri district are investigating circumstances surrounding the death of a 73 year old woman whose body was discovered in the kitchen lying dead.

According to the Kigezi Region Police spokesperson ASP Elly Maate, the deceased was identified as Kogyire Lydia a resident of Bugarama cell, Bugangari parish, Bugangari Sub County in Rukungiri District.

According to the Police mouthpiece, the matter was reported to Police by Piason Atwongirwe, a teacher at Nyanganjara Primary School, a resident of the same area, who alleges that the deceased was discovered by Turyakira Jackeline who found her body lying in the Kitchen that was temporarily closed with an unlocked padlock.

It is alleged that on Sunday morning Kongyire Lydia, now the deceased was seen by her son Akankwasa Keleb doing domestic work at her home and at around 5:30 PM, Turyakira Jackeline while coming from Bugangari church headed to her home found Akankwasa Kereb and Ainembabazi Elias (Grandsons to the deceased) at Akankwasa’s home.

She was told by Ainembabazi Elias that he had come to visit her grandmother and she (Jacklin) proceeded to her home a few meters to Kogyire’s home to change clothes before checking on the neighbor (now the deceased) to inform her the message from the church as usual.

Upon reaching Jacklin’s, she found the main house open ,called but no response and went ahead to cross-check in the kitchen that she found it temporarily closed. Upon opening the door, she saw the leg of the deceased lying dead from which she went back immediately, notified the grandsons and continued to inform others.

Maate said the Police officers were able to visit the Crime scene and the deceased’s body was conveyed to Rwakabengo health center III mortuary pending postmortem examination as well as arresting Akankwasa Keleb the deceased’s grandson to assist in investigations.

A case of Murder was registered at Bugangari Police station on the file Number SD REF:  06/10/09/2023 as more Inquiries are at hand waiting to revisit the crime scene for proper documentation and evidence gathering.

The murder incident came just hours after another woman was killed in Buhunga Sub County of Rukungiri District on Friday on allegations of witchcraft.
